Hey, welcome aboard! Quick handover on undo/redo in SketchLoom's diagram editor: we use a command stack, and every canvas action must push an invertible command or undo silently breaks. The tricky bits are grouped moves and connector reroutes — see the CommandMerge notes in the wiki. If you touch the history stack at all, loop in the person who owns it.

account owner for bawip-tahag: Raleth Quenok

Kestrelgate is eight weeks behind schedule. Root causes: underestimated data migration effort, two senior engineers reassigned to the Ombra launch, and late vendor deliverables. Budget overrun currently 12%. Mitigations in place: scope freeze, weekly steering calls chaired by Deren Valk, contractor backfill approved. Revised go-live is mid-April; confidence moderate. No customer commitments are at risk yet. Recommendation: hold scope, deny further change requests this quarter. Strategic context for the board's decision follows directly below.

confidential, kagup-bafog: Fraaxax Group is in early talks to buy Soroxox Group for about $343.8 million. The Olidor launch date is June 14, and nothing goes to the press before then. Legal wants the Aldmirek Logistics term sheet signed before July 23.

**Finance Review – Vennhall Supplies Renewal**

Quick recap for the team: the Vennhall contract renewal came in roughly where we hoped. Pricing holds flat for year one, with a 2% bump in year two — better than the 5% they opened with. Delivery terms unchanged, payment terms stretch to 45 days. Marta's team did solid work here. One item stays off the wider circulation list for now.

management briefing: Project Ulavan slips by two quarters because of the staffing delay.